VIDEO: DSS, police take over Lagos Assembly

On Monday, officials from the Department of State Security (DSS) and the Nigeria Police took control of the Lagos State House of Assembly.

They secured the assembly at Alausa, Ikeja, to ensure sufficient protection.

Mojisola Meranda, the Speaker of the House, reportedly arrived around 12 pm with her convoy.

After her arrival, the House proceeded with plenary, with the lawmakers expressing trust in her leadership.

It was reported that the recently removed speaker, Obasa, was dismissed by 32 out of 40 members of the House on January 13, 2025, while he was in the United States.
